Costs and Efficiency:

Price and efficiency are key factors when choosing a car – and this is often where the real differences emerge.

Toyota RAV4 has a decisively advantage in terms of price – it starts at 35100 £, while the BMW X4 costs 51900 £. That’s a price difference of around 16723 £.

Fuel consumption also shows a difference: Toyota RAV4 manages with 1 L and is therefore convincingly more efficient than the BMW X4 with 6 L. The difference is about 5 L per 100 km.

Engine and Performance:

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.

When it comes to engine power, the BMW X4 has a distinct edge – offering 510 HP compared to 306 HP. That’s roughly 204 HP more horsepower.

In ac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h, the BMW X4 is decisively quicker – completing the sprint in 3.80 s, while the Toyota RAV4 takes 6 s. That’s about 2.20 s faster.

In terms of top speed, the BMW X4 performs evident better – reaching 250 km/h, while the Toyota RAV4 tops out at 180 km/h. The difference is around 70 km/h.

Space and Everyday Use:

Whether family car or daily driver – which one offers more room, flexibility and comfort?

In curb weight, Toyota RAV4 is minimal lighter – 1745 kg compared to 1875 kg. The difference is around 130 kg.

In terms of boot space, the Toyota RAV4 offers slight more room – 580 L compared to 525 L. That’s a difference of about 55 L.

In maximum load capacity, the Toyota RAV4 performs slightly better – up to 1690 L, which is about 260 L more than the BMW X4.

When it comes to payload, Toyota RAV4 hardly perceptible takes the win – 600 kg compared to 545 kg. That’s a difference of about 55 kg.
